In Treatment of Bacterial infections : Norflocure 400 Tablet is an antibiotic medicine which can be used to treat many different infections caused by bacteria. It stops the growth of the bacteria causing the infection and clears the infection. It also helps treat as well as prevent diarrhea that may occur due to the use of this medicine or due to stomach/gut(intestine) infections.Take it for as long as prescribed by the doctor and avoid skipping doses. This will make sure that all bacteria are killed and they do not become resistant.
Side effects of Norflocure Tablet The majority of side effects typically do not necessitate medical intervention. and disappear as your body adjusts to the medicine. Doctor consultation is advised if they persist or if you�re worried about them Common side effects of Norflocure Nausea Dizziness Headache Increased white blood cell count (eosinophils)Abdominal cramp Increased aspartate aminotransferase Increased alanine aminotransferase Decreased white blood cell count (lymphocytes)Low blood platelets Protein in urine Increased alkaline phosphatase level in blood
How to use Norflocure Tablet Follow your doctor's guidance regarding the dose and duration of this medication. Ingest it without breaking or crushing. Do not chew, crush or break it. Norflocure 400 Tablet is to be taken empty stomach.
How Norflocure Tablet works Norflocure 400 Tablet is a combination of two medicines. Norfloxacin is an antibiotic. It works by stopping the action of a bacterial enzyme called DNA-gyrase. This prevents bacterial cells from dividing and repairing, thereby killing them.�Lactobacillus is a probiotic. It works by restoring the balance of good bacteria in the intestine that may get upset after antibiotic use or due to intestinal infections.�This is how it works to treat bacterial infections.
Unsafe: Avoid consuming alcohol with Norflocure 400 Tablet as it is deemed unsafe.
Information regarding the use of Norflocure 400 Tablet during pregnancy is not available. Doctor consultation is advised.
Information regarding the use of Norflocure 400 Tablet during breastfeeding is not available. Doctor consultation is advised.
It is not known whether Norflocure 400 Tablet alters the ability to drive. Do not drive if you experience any symptoms that affect your ability to concentrate and react.
Norflocure 400 Tablet should be used with caution in patients with kidney disease. Dose adjustment of Norflocure 400 Tablet may be needed. Doctor consultation is advised.
There is limited information available on the use of Norflocure 400 Tablet in patients with liver disease. Doctor consultation is advised.
If a dose of Norflocure 400 Tablet is missed, take it promptly. However, if your next dose is approaching, skip the missed dose and resume your regular schedule. Avoid doubling the dose.
